This is the first book, in Rachel Hanna’s newest series, Jubilee. As usual, this author does not disappoint. This book has the same feel to it as you would expect from a Rachel Hanna book.

Madeline is a famous author who has been down on her luck. Her marriage broke up and now her new book isn’t selling. Her agent suggests she write about a small town since this is what the readers are reading now. The problem is that Madeline is from the city and doesn’t know anything about small-town living. So at the suggestion of her agent, she temporarily moves to a little town in the Blue Ridge Mountains called Jubilee. It’s a wonderful small town with some quirky residents and her sexy neighbor, Brady.

I fell in love with Geneve, the 96-year-old resident who is as spry as ever and has a lot of wisdom, which she offers to Madeline.

Can this small-town girl survive, or will she ache to head back to the city?

I think you will love this book as much as I did. I just wish Jubilee wasn’t a fictional town so I could visit and meet these residents that I fell in love with. If you love a book about new beginnings, small town living in the mountains with wonderful characters, a goat named Gilbert, and some romance thrown in, you will love this book.

Wow, Just wow. That is how this book left me feeling. Rachel never disappoints. This book had me captivated by the very first word until the very end.

Jill’s best friend, Monica , dies way too young. To Jill’s surprise, she is in Monica’s will, but there is a catch. Monica left her a bucket list that she wants Jill to complete. She has to complete each task and then blog about it. Monica’s lawyer will keep up with the blog to confirm that each task is completed.

Jill has anxiety and she is not adventurous at all. Her husband died suddenly 15 years ago and it takes everything in her just to get out of the house. Of course her best friend Monica was the complete opposite and would go on all sorts of adventures. This is Monica’s way to get Jill out of her comfort zone.

This book was very relatable. I loved all of the characters but I could really relate to Jill in so many ways.

It is hilarious, sweet, romantic and all about discovering things about yourself that you didn’t know existed. I highly recommend this book.

This was the first book I read by Rachel Hanna and it got me hooked on her books. It is probably still my favorite.

Julie has been married for over 20 years with 2 grown daughters and one day her husband announces to him that he is leaving her. He has met someone else and to make matters worse, he tells her they have a 6 month old son. All of this happened after they sold their house and made plans to move to a beach house. Julie is flabergasted and can’t believe this is happening to her. So he tells her the offer on their house went through but the beach house isn’t going to happen. So here is Julie with no home and no husband.

She didn’t know what to do and just wanted to start over somewhere new so she did something that probably wasn’t the smartest idea at the time. She bought a fixer up house on an island off the coast of South Carolina. She had never been there so she picked up her life and moved. The house was in worst shape than she ever imagined[. Then she met Dawson and he is the local contractor so helps her fix up her house. And of course their is Chemistry.

Then her extranged sister and mom show up so their is drama. I think my favorite character is the southern belle, Dixie who owns the local bookstore where Julie eventually works.

This is great read and made me want to read more.
